Youth Stewardship & Professional Skills (YSP) Program - Energize for Climate!
Thank you for your interest in our Youth Stewardship & Professional Skills (YSP) Program! This program is open to youth in the Hamilton Region looking to get involved with issues relating to climate change. The theme for the summer session is all about energy and sustainable ways for youth to conserve energy in their daily lives. Over the course of the summer you will learn some fundamental skills through the construction of a environmental stewardship project of your choice, and have the opportunity to make your project a reality. This is a great program to build up your resume, connect with like-minded peers interested in environmentalism, and will make a difference in your community!

In joining this program, you can:

• earn a minimum of 18 community service / volunteer hours
• gain valuable professional skills and experience
• receive letters of recommendation as needed
• complete a stewardship project that benefits the environment
• meet other high school students that value sustainable living
• have fun in nature this summer!
